What are the key skills and qualifications needed to thrive as a Temp Robot Programmer, and why are they important?

To thrive as a Temp Robot Programmer, you need a solid background in robotics, programming (such as Python, C++, or proprietary robot languages), and automation systems, typically supported by relevant technical education or experience. Familiarity with industrial robots (e.g., ABB, FANUC, KUKA), PLCs, and simulation software is often required, along with certifications in robotics or automation. Strong problem-solving skills, attention to detail, and effective communication help you adapt quickly to new environments and collaborate with engineering teams. These skills are vital for efficiently developing, testing, and troubleshooting robotic solutions in dynamic, project-based assignments.

What are the typical challenges faced by someone in a Temp Robot Programming position, and how can they be addressed?

Temp Robot Programming roles often require quickly adapting to new robotic platforms and unfamiliar work environments. Common challenges include understanding proprietary programming languages, integrating robots with existing systems, and troubleshooting issues under tight deadlines. Success in this role often depends on strong problem-solving skills, the ability to learn quickly, and effective communication with permanent staff and engineers. Being proactive in seeking help and thoroughly documenting your work can ease the transition and ensure project continuity after your assignment ends.

What are Temp Robot Programmers?

Temp Robot Programmers are professionals hired on a temporary basis to program, configure, and troubleshoot robots used in manufacturing, automation, or other industries. They typically work with robotic systems to ensure they perform tasks efficiently and according to specifications. These programmers may write or modify code, test robotic movements, and collaborate with engineering teams to integrate robots into existing workflows. Temp roles are often project-based, providing flexibility for companies to scale their workforce based on demand.

A day in the life
Your day begins by reviewing system performance reports for your region. Perhaps the metrics dashboard revealed unusual performance at a FL facility or spare parts dropped below threshold at a GA site. You analyze metrics to identify trends and risks, developing de-risking actions for leadership's weekly business review. You troubleshoot with RME technicians via video, walking them through diagnostic procedures. On-site, you conduct hardware audits for new deployments, gathering customer feedback. Afternoons include designing tools, optimizing processes, and coordinating with regional managers on scaling strategies. Throughout, you're the critical link between field technicians and engineering teams.

Amazon.com, Inc., commonly known as Amazon, is an American multinational technology company. It was founded by Jeff Bezos in 1994 and initially started as an online marketplace for books. Since then, Amazon has expanded its operations and become one of the largest e-commerce companies in the world. Amazon's primary business is its online retail platform, where customers can purchase a vast array of products, including electronics, clothing, books, home goods, and much more. The company offers a convenient and user-friendly shopping experience, with features such as fast shipping, customer reviews, and personalized recommendations. In addition to its e-commerce platform, Amazon has diversified its business into various other areas. One of its notable ventures is Amazon Web Services (AWS), a comprehensive cloud computing platform that provides services such as storage, compute power, and database management to individuals and businesses. AWS has become a leader in the cloud computing industry, powering many websites and applications worldwide. Amazon has also developed its own consumer electronics, including the popular Amazon Kindle e-reader, Fire tablets, Fire TV streaming devices, and the Alexa-powered Echo smart speakers. The Alexa voice assistant, integrated into these devices, allows users to interact with their devices using voice commands, perform tasks, and access information. Furthermore, Amazon has expanded into media and entertainment. It operates Prime Video, a streaming service that offers a wide range of movies, TV shows, and original content. Amazon Music provides a platform for streaming and purchasing digital music, while Audible offers audiobooks and other audio content. The company's commitment to customer satisfaction and convenience is demonstrated by its membership program, Amazon Prime. Prime members receive various benefits, including free two-day shipping, access to streaming services, exclusive deals, and more.
